teflon strips, also known as PTFE strips, are versatile and durable material that find a wide array of applications in different industries. Teflon is a brand name for polytetrafluoroethylene (PTFE), a synthetic polymer with unique properties that make it valuable in various applications. teflon strips are made from this material and are commonly used in industries like food processing, automotive, manufacturing, and more. One of the key properties of Teflon strips is their excellent non-stick surface. Teflon is widely known for its low coefficient of friction, which makes it a perfect material for applications where surfaces need to slide smoothly against each other. Teflon strips are often used in food processing equipment like conveyors, chutes, and guide rails to prevent food from sticking and ensure smooth operation. The non-stick surface of Teflon also makes it easier to clean, reducing maintenance time and costs.

Another important property of Teflon strips is their high temperature resistance. Teflon can withstand temperatures ranging from -200°C to 260°C, making it ideal for applications where extreme heat is involved. This temperature resistance makes Teflon strips suitable for use in ovens, grills, and other high-temperature equipment where other materials would fail. Teflon strips can withstand constant exposure to high temperatures without degrading, making them a reliable choice for demanding applications.

In addition to their non-stick and temperature resistance properties, Teflon strips are also chemically inert. Teflon is highly resistant to chemicals, acids, and solvents, making it a popular choice for applications where exposure to harsh chemicals is a concern. Teflon strips are used in chemical processing equipment, storage tanks, and piping systems to prevent corrosion and ensure long-term durability. The chemical resistance of Teflon also makes it suitable for pharmaceutical, medical, and laboratory applications where purity and cleanliness are crucial.

Teflon strips are available in a variety of sizes, thicknesses, and configurations to suit different applications. They can be easily cut, shaped, and installed to fit specific requirements, making them a versatile solution for various industries. Teflon strips can be used as wear strips, guide rails, sealants, gaskets, and more, providing a cost-effective and reliable solution for a wide range of applications. Their ease of installation and maintenance make them a popular choice for manufacturers looking to improve efficiency and reduce downtime.

One of the main advantages of Teflon strips is their longevity. Teflon is a durable material that can last for years without losing its properties, making it a cost-effective choice in the long run. Teflon strips require minimal maintenance and can withstand heavy use, making them a reliable solution for demanding applications. The longevity of Teflon strips also reduces the need for frequent replacements, saving time and money for businesses in the long term.
